PM Modi greets nation on Guru Purnima, pays tribute to Guru-disciple tradition

Prime Minister Narendra Modi extended Guru Purnima greetings, paying tribute to India's Guru-disciple tradition and the role of teachers in shaping lives with knowledge and values. Union ministers Amit Shah and Rajnath Singh, along with Uttar Pradesh Chief Minister Yogi Adityanath, also conveyed their wishes

Prime Minister Narendra Modi on Wednesday extended greetings to the nation on the occasion of Guru Purnima, paying tribute to the timeless Guru-disciple tradition and highlighting the role of teachers in shaping lives through knowledge, values and positive energy.

In a post on X, the Prime Minister said, "Heartiest congratulations to all fellow citizens on Guru Purnima. The Guru, along with imparting knowledge, instils positive energy in their disciples, educating them with noble thoughts and refined values. Let us make their ideals the cornerstone of our lives."
